Our Responsible Travel Page
 

We at Thailand weddings.com are members and supporters of Responsibletravel.com As we believe in the values the company was founded on and believe that we all have cultural and ecological responsibilities to live up to.

How choosing us makes a difference!

We as a small business have always believed in helping and giving back to our community and have done so by helping promote and start several community based self help projects, from a small coffee company, tribal handicraft co-op, handicapped NGO, to a local reforestation projects in the area of our venue.

As part of our local community, we invite local elders to help and partake in our Buddhist weddings. They will not accept payment for such things, but they do receive a chance to enjoy some excellent food and entertainment as well as to be shown the respect that local culture bestows upon our elderly. It is so import to provide all people a sense of self worth and usefulness, thus keeping our culture alive in Thailand today. We also try to promote Thai culture, Thai music and dramatical arts by hiring local professionally trained musicians and dancers and other performers for our weddings.

We recommend to our wedding guests great local producers and suppliers of local products like jewellery, wood carvings and silk and even assist in translating as often the best producers do not speak much English. We also tell them of non touristy markets and places to find the best deals. As well as great local restaurants where authentic local northern Thai cuisine may be found. We can also recommend some fun things to do like elephant ride, treks, mountain biking tours or even golf courses.

 

Our property was an abandoned farm due to the fact the slash and burn style farming practices had left the soil commercially unusable. With hard work and good soil restoration and management techniques and lots of loving care, it has been reclaimed to the point of a garden paradise - wedding venue (Thanks mostly to our original head gardener "Khun Sea"). An adjacent small organic orchard growing old style Thai fruits and some of the land being reforested in Thai golden teak trees and other trees for future generations to enjoy and manage are all part of our overall wedding venue.

Even our wedding house is made from recycled teak and other woods from two old houses that were being torn down in favour of new concrete homes, so no new lumber was used in our main building.

Our other buildings are made from mostly locally source materials like thatched roofing material or recycled tiles. We do use gray water to water part of our garden, we recycle all paper, old metal, plastic but it is normal here and viable economically too. Of course we compost organic waste what little have to help rebuild our soil. We also have mostly long life energy gas lighting or candles. We have air conditioning or fan if preferred but with our planting around the house we find a small micro climate developing and the need for air conditioning most of all the time.

The local staff knows the importance of water and energy conservation good environmental practices as here we all traditionally try to live with nature and accept when we do not the price to pay is high.

We employ 100% local staff from northern Thailand, most from the local area. We offer better than average wages and opportunities to all staff members. We have provided on the job training to all staff and sub suppliers on building professional skills in whatever area of employment they are in from gardeners to kitchen staff and even the drivers.

We offer employment opportunities to those not usually able to find work such as a hearing impaired individual, as well as illiterate workers, single mothers and local Hill tribe people. This is not to say the service one receives is not the best there is, but just the contrary, ensuring your service with genuine whole hearted enthusiasm and appreciation of you coming to our small corner of the world to marry, has helped make possible a better life for so many. Yet we feel we can offer you a unique and wonderful experience too, a perfect wedding.

We as a business and in conjunction with our staff have also helped with local and hill tribe students with tuitions and finacial assistance when needed. At present we endevouring to set up a more formal and structured procedure to aid in such works. Which will enable couples and guests to help in as well. In the past some caring guests have donated funds and asked us to make sure it goes to those who really need it and will truly benifet from thier help.We have done so, but only on an unofficial basis and see a need for a more formal process.
